Chicken Chili Pot (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

01 - 4 chicken breasts.
02 - 4 oz softened cream cheese.
03 - 19 oz drained white kidney beans.
04 - 2 cups chicken broth (low sodium).
05 - 3/4 teaspoon salt.
06 - Cornstarch and water mixture for thickening.
07 - 2-3 teaspoons chili powder.
08 - 4.3 oz green chiles.
09 - 1 medium chopped onion.
10 - 12 oz drained corn.

# Instructions:

01 - Throw the beans, corn, onion, broth, chiles, and spices into the pot.
02 - Lay chicken breasts into the liquid and push them under.
03 - Set to cook under high pressure for 10 minutes, then let it naturally sit for another 10.
04 - Pull out the chicken, shred it into pieces, and toss it back in the pot.
05 - Stir in chunks of cream cheese until smooth. Thicken up the liquid with cornstarch if you want.

# Notes:

01 - Frozen chicken works, just give it extra time.
02 - Use cornstarch if the broth feels too thin.
03 - Dress it up your way with toppings.
